The Bank of Italy has launched a consultation providing for a set of provisions intended to give full implementation to Capital Requirements Directive (CRD IV) in Italy in connection with the newly established remuneration policy requirements for banks, banking groups, investment firms and groups of investment firms. Comments need to be submitted to the Bank of Italy by 12 January 2014.

The Bank of Italy has also launched a further consultation provides for a set of provisions intended to give full implementation to the CRD IV in Italy in connection with the requirements provided for under CRD IV in terms of the internal organisation and governance of banks. Comments on this second consultation need to be submitted to the Bank of Italy by 14 January 2014.
